Greek Strong's Léksiko
G1759
Lemma: ἐνθάδε
Transliterashon: en-thad'-eh
Definishon: from a prolonged form of ἐν; properly, within, i.e. (of place) here, hither
KJV Definishon: (t-)here, hither
